Preventing leg cramps during exercise
1. Perform warm-up activities before starting the movement
Before engaging in any strenuous exercise, it is important to perform adequate warm-up activities. This includes giving proper massage and stretching to the leg muscles to ensure smooth blood circulation in the lower limbs before participating in intense workouts or competitions; During the warm-up, try to keep your legs straight and bend your toes towards your body. Once a cramp occurs during exercise, this method can also be used to help the muscle relax again. Relaxing your body and then stretching it out can help alleviate cramps.

3. Drink more beverages
Stay warm during exercise and drink plenty of fluids, especially those that contain a small amount of salt. In this way, not only can you replenish fluids, but you can also maintain the body’s acid-base balance. However, it’s still best to avoid carbonated drinks altogether. Drinking salt water promptly after excessive sweating can also help prevent leg cramps. Within one hour after finishing the run, it is also necessary to consume about 1.5 liters of fluid.
